- [ ] Step 7: Archive cold storage buckets (Glacierline tier). Confirm both ceremony witnesses are present, verify bucket manifests match the Oxbow ledger, then seal the archive key shares. Plugin authors may observe but not handle shares. Once sealed, the archive index itself is encrypted and can only be reopened with the passphrase below.

vault phrase of badup-hahig = tamael-aldael-kelmir-istael-fenok-istwyn-tamius-jorath-oliion

# Data Stores: Monthly Partitioning

The Corvetta reporting tables are partitioned by calendar month on the event timestamp. New partitions are created automatically on the first of each month by the scheduler; old ones are detached after 13 months and archived. When a customer reports missing rows, confirm the query targets the correct partition range before escalating. For read-only verification against the partition catalog, use the connection string below.

primary connection of yagep-kahip = redis://giliel_svc:zYiKsLL2PLpfPL@db-348f.xolmarsys.corp:5432/fenwyn

Notes from the Fernwhistle plugin sync. The feed validator now rejects episodes missing duration tags; plugin authors should update before the next cutoff. Strict mode becomes the default in version 4. Sample feeds and the conformance suite are in the partner portal. Questions about validator rules go to the maintainer listed below.

named custodian: Brivan Eliath Quenox Frador

## Sensor drift: what to do at 3am

If the GrowLoop controller starts reporting humidity swings that don't match the backup probes in the Fernwick greenhouse, it's almost always sensor drift, not an actual climate event. Don't panic and don't touch the vents manually. First, restart the calibration daemon and give it ten minutes to re-baseline. If readings still disagree by more than 5%, flip the controller into safe mode. The safe-mode thresholds it will use are these.

config for yahap-bajof:
[istix]
host = istix.qorvelsys.internal
user = istix_svc
database = istix_prod